We <br /> offer the following preliminary recommendations to minimize impacts to aquatic and terrestrial wildlife <br /> resources. <br /> 1. Since Watery Fork and Hudson creeks occur on site,we highly recommend maintain a minimum <br /> 100-foot undisturbed,native, forested buffer along perennial streams, and a minimum 50-foot <br /> buffer along intermittent streams and wetlands. Maintaining undisturbed, forested buffers along <br /> these areas will minimize impacts to aquatic and terrestrial wildlife resources,water quality,and <br /> aquatic habitat both within and downstream of the project area. Also,wide riparian buffers are <br /> helpful in maintaining stability of stream banks and for treatment of pollutants associated with <br /> urban stormwater. <br /> 2. We recommend designing the subdivision with the lots located in previously cleared and <br /> disturbed areas(pasture) and minimizing the amount of trees and other native vegetation that will <br /> be cleared for the development. <br /> 3. Avoid tree clearing activities during the maternity roosting season for bats(May 15 —August 15) <br /> because of the decline in populations of several bat species, including the proposed endangered <br /> tricolored bat. <br /> 4. NCWRC may request surveys for the presence of state protected mussel species if streams are <br /> impacted. <br /> 5. Use non-invasive native species and Low Impact Development(LID)technology in landscaping. <br /> Using LID technology in landscaping will not only help maintain the predevelopment hydrologic <br /> regime,but also enhance the aesthetic and habitat value of the site. LID techniques include <br /> permeable pavement,narrower roads, and bioretention areas(ex. rain gardens)that can collect <br /> stormwater from driveways and parking areas. Additional information on LID can be found at the <br /> NC State University LID guide: https://www.uni-grououpusa.org/PDF/NC_LID_Guidebook.pdf. <br /> Consider constructing the subdivision as a wildlife friendly development <br /> (https://www.ncwildcertify.org_/).Also,NCWRC's Green Growth Toolbox provides information <br /> on nature-friendly planning <br /> (http://www.ncwildlife.org/Conservin /ograms/GreenGrowthToolbox.aspx). <br /> 6. Re-seed disturbed areas with seed mixtures or native plants that are beneficial to wildlife. Avoid <br /> using invasive,non-native plants(i.e.,tall fescue,lespedeza,nadina, and Bermudagrass)in seed <br /> mixtures or landscaping plants(http://www.ncwildflower.oriz/plant galleries/invasives list). In <br /> open areas, consider planting native,wildflower seed mixes that will create pollinator habitat <br /> within the project boundary. <br /> 7. We recommend using green construction techniques to improve water,waste, and energy <br /> efficiency. Consider using wildlife friendly outdoor lighting since light pollution can impact the <br /> circadian rhythms of animals,disrupt behavior,cause injury, or death. Lights should only be on <br /> when needed;use lights only where necessary; lights should have wavelength greater than 560 <br /> nm emissions(i.e.,narrow-spectrum LEDs or low-pressure sodium);mount the fixture as low as <br /> possible;use the lowest wattage necessary; and lights should be fully shielded. <br /> 8. Erosion and sediment control measures should conform to the High Quality Water Zones <br /> standards stipulated in the NC Department of Environmental Quality Erosion and Sediment <br /> Control Plan(htips:Hdeq.nc.gov/about/divisions/energy-mineral-land-resources/energy-mineral- <br /> land-permit-guidance/erosion-sediment-control-planning design-manual). Sediment and erosion <br /> control measures should use advanced methods and installed prior to any land-disturbing activity. <br /> 9.
